Home
last modified time | relevance | path

Searched refs:pdev_wd (Results 1 – 3 of 3) sorted by relevance

/linux-6.1.9/arch/mips/sgi-ip30/
Dip30-xtalk.c43 struct platform_device *pdev_wd; in bridge_platform_create() local
62 pdev_wd = platform_device_alloc("sgi_w1", PLATFORM_DEVID_AUTO); in bridge_platform_create()
63 if (!pdev_wd) { in bridge_platform_create()
67 if (platform_device_add_resources(pdev_wd, &w1_res, 1)) { in bridge_platform_create()
71 if (platform_device_add_data(pdev_wd, wd, sizeof(*wd))) { in bridge_platform_create()
75 if (platform_device_add(pdev_wd)) { in bridge_platform_create()
128 platform_device_unregister(pdev_wd); in bridge_platform_create()
131 platform_device_put(pdev_wd); in bridge_platform_create()
/linux-6.1.9/arch/mips/sgi-ip27/
Dip27-xtalk.c30 struct platform_device *pdev_wd; in bridge_platform_create() local
52 pdev_wd = platform_device_alloc("sgi_w1", PLATFORM_DEVID_AUTO); in bridge_platform_create()
53 if (!pdev_wd) { in bridge_platform_create()
57 if (platform_device_add_resources(pdev_wd, &w1_res, 1)) { in bridge_platform_create()
61 if (platform_device_add_data(pdev_wd, wd, sizeof(*wd))) { in bridge_platform_create()
65 if (platform_device_add(pdev_wd)) { in bridge_platform_create()
119 platform_device_unregister(pdev_wd); in bridge_platform_create()
122 platform_device_put(pdev_wd); in bridge_platform_create()
/linux-6.1.9/drivers/platform/x86/
Dmlx-platform.c300 struct platform_device *pdev_wd[MLXPLAT_CPLD_WD_MAX_DEVS]; member
5315 priv->pdev_wd[j] = in mlxplat_init()
5319 if (IS_ERR(priv->pdev_wd[j])) { in mlxplat_init()
5320 err = PTR_ERR(priv->pdev_wd[j]); in mlxplat_init()
5336 platform_device_unregister(priv->pdev_wd[j]); in mlxplat_init()
5365 platform_device_unregister(priv->pdev_wd[i]); in mlxplat_exit()